BeOS
BeOS is an operating system for personal computers first developed by Be Inc. in 1991.

Linux
Linux is a family of free and open-source software operating systems built around the Linux kernel.

OS/2
OS/2 is a series of computer operating systems, initially created by Microsoft and IBM under the leadership of IBM software designer Ed Iacobucci.
